General Description
AMMONIUM O,O-DIISOPROPYLTHIOPHOSPHATE is an organophosphate compound that is commonly used as a pesticide. It is a cholinesterase inhibitor, meaning that it disrupts the function of the enzyme that breaks down the neurotransmitter acetylcholine in the nervous system. This can lead to overstimulation of cholinergic receptors, resulting in symptoms such as muscle twitching, excessive salivation, and eventually respiratory failure. Due to its toxicity, AMMONIUM O,O-DIISOPROPYLTHIOPHOSPHATE is considered a highly hazardous chemical and must be handled with care and proper protective equipment. Additionally, its use as a pesticide is strictly regulated to minimize environmental and human health risks.
Check Digit Verification of cas no
The CAS Registry Mumber 29918-57-8 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,9,9,1 and 8 respectively; the second part has 2 digits, 5 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 29918-57:
(7*2)+(6*9)+(5*9)+(4*1)+(3*8)+(2*5)+(1*7)=158
158 % 10 = 8
So 29918-57-8 is a valid CAS Registry Number.

SYNTHESIS AND TRIBOCHEMICAL BEHAVIOUR OF SOME MONOTHIOPHOSPHORIC ACID DERIVATIVES
Zinke, Horst,Schumacher, Rolf
, p. 315 - 322 (2007/10/02)
Diisopropylphosphite reacts, with sulphur and ammonia to form ammonium monothiophosphoric acid-diisopropylester which, by subsequent reaction with different monochloroacetic acid esters, yields the corresponding monothiophosphoric-acid-O,O-diisopropyl-S-carboalkoximethylesters.These compounds show different wear- and friction-reduction properties in lubricating oils.The tribochemical activity at higher temperatures increases with the chain length of the carboxylic ester group.Auger electron spectroscopy (AES) of the worn metal surface shows that the wear reducing properties correspond with the phosphorus content in the metal surface produced by tribofragmentation of the monothiophosphates.A possible explanation of this effect is discussed.
